Overview Herpisafe 250mg Injection
Acyclovir 250mg injection is an antiviral medication used to treat various viral infections, including cold sores (herpes labialis), herpes simplex, shingles (herpes zoster), genital herpes, and chickenpox. This medication functions by inhibiting viral replication within human cells, thus aiding in infection resolution. Administration is strictly by intravenous (IV) infusion over one hour by a qualified medical professional; self-administration is contraindicated. Slow infusion minimizes potential kidney harm. Adequate hydration is crucial during treatment to prevent dehydration and reduce kidney stress. Potential adverse effects may include nausea, vomiting, and elevated liver enzyme levels. Injection site reactions such as pain, swelling, or redness are also possible. Prolonged side effects warrant medical consultation. Pregnant individuals, those planning pregnancy, or breastfeeding mothers should seek medical advice before using this medication.

SAFETY ADVICE
AlcoholC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
Alcohol consumption alongside Herpisafe 250mg Injection may pose unknown risks. Seek medical advice before combining them.
PregnancySAFE IF PRESCRIBED
The injectable formulation of Herpisafe, 250mg, is typically deemed safe for use during gestation. Preclinical trials using animals have revealed minimal or no negative consequences for fetal development; yet, data from human trials remain scarce.
Breast feedingSAFE IF PRESCRIBED
Administration of Herpisafe 250mg Injection is considered safe for breastfeeding mothers. Research in humans indicates minimal drug transfer to breast milk, posing no known risk to the infant.
DrivingSAFE
Administration of Herpisafe 250mg Injection typically does not impair driving ability.
KidneyCAUTION
Individuals with kidney impairment should exercise caution when using Herpisafe 250mg Injection, as dosage modification may be necessary. Physician consultation is recommended. Adequate hydration is advised during treatment.
LiverCAUTION
Individuals with hepatic impairment should use Herpisafe 250mg Injection cautiously. Dosage modification for Herpisafe 250mg Injection may be necessary. Physician consultation is advised.
